Transaction 8dd8c993008f6832428457b89a1d346c5117d74a0daa90167dad0cefac07d627
1 Input
1 Output
-
8dd8c993008f6832428457b89a1d346c5117d74a0daa90167dad0cefac07d627:0
- value
- 650400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0b84b3f7aa2549752825d4cf000ce9a3e7bff75d OP_EQUAL
- address
- 32jvL26vqTfHdXDZBrQ24gZ48MRFwe1eo5